BagoSphere and Ateneo de Manila University seal partnership on training for the employment of disadvantaged youth

 

Great news from one of our grantees – BagoSphere! For the past 8 years, BagoSphere has been helping disadvantaged Filipino youth build their interpersonal skills and mindsets to enter the workforce, starting with the BPO and Microfinance industries. BagoSphere has trained over 5,000 people, across 8 cities and 3 job training centers. The BPO job training programs provide an 85% job placement rate while BagoSphere’s corporate programs are helping one of the largest microfinance companies in the Philippines reduce their attrition by 70%, saving them US$400k per year.

BagoSphere believes that human skills (such as interpersonal communication, self-awareness, resilience, managing emotions, empathy) are the missing link connecting, reinforcing, and developing other skills. Their programs train young people with a holistic approach, build their human skills and place them in formal jobs, fundamentally changing their life trajectories in a fast-changing world.
